    A Study on the Evaluation of Forest Ecosystem Quality and Its Influencing Factors in Guangxi

    • The forests of Guangxi represent a significant collective forest area and a vital ecological security barrier in southern China.It is the first modern forestry industry demonstration zone jointly built by the central and local governments.Evaluating and monitoring forest ecosystem quality can provide theoretical support for the high-quality development of forests and the realization of ecological civilization value.Based on monitoring data from 147 forest plots in Guangxi in 2022,eight evaluation indicators were selected across three dimensions of forest productivity,forest structure and ecological stress of forest ecosystem.The analytic hierarchy process was used to assign weights to the indicators,and a weighted summation method was applied to calculate the quality index scores for each forest ecosystem sample plot.The random forest model was used to analyze the influencing factors.The results showed that:①The comprehensive index of forest ecosystem quality in Guangxi in 2022 was 70.99,which falls into the "good" category.All 147 plots were rated as either good or excellent in ecological quality,with the overall forest ecosystem quality showing a gradual decline from the southeast to the northwest.②Among different forest types,coniferous and broad-leaved mixed forests had the highest ecosystem quality index (72.03),followed by evergreen and deciduous broad-leaved mixed forests (71.62),evergreen broad-leaved forests (70.86),subtropical coniferous forests (70.60),bamboo forests (70.25) and artificial forests (68.55).Mountain shrublands had the lowest ecosystem quality index (65.73).③Precipitation had the strongest influence on the forest ecosystem quality index in Guangxi (0.263),followed by resident population (0.157, soil clay content (0.148) and soil organic carbon storage (0.103).The influences of temperature,topographic factors (slope aspect,altitude and slope gradient) and soil pH were all below 0.1.The evaluation index system and research conclusions of forest ecosystem quality proposed in this paper can provide an important theoretical reference for the monitoring and evaluation of regional forest ecosystem quality.
